Christmas
an Irrational Season
Artist: Carolyn Arends Label: Independent URL: http://www.carolynarends.com Length: 13 Tracks / 46:40 Carolyn Arends is best known for her stint with Reunion Records. Since that stint ended, she has been recording independently and this is her first Christmas CD. By the time the listener is done with the prelude, it is obvious that this is a thinking person's Christmas project. This is a project that will make the listener think about the Christmas season and what it means. The prelude also helps set the stage for this CD as it shows off the folk sound of the album, mixed with strings from a traditional carol. This is not a project of traditional carols as there are only a few on this CD. Some songs also have original arrangements of traditional carols. The other songs on this CD are original and written by Carolyn Arends, except for "Christmas Must Be Tonight," which was written by Robbie Robertson in 1977. The songs on this album are songs that focus on more than just the obvious and really make the listener focus on things not normally considered such as the implications of the Christmas story. This is a thinking person's Christmas CD with its folk songs that also help the listeners contemplate the meaning and implications of the Christmas story. Burton Wray
